Scope and Contents

The Pat Lowery Collins Papers contains drafts, proofs, research, and correspondence related to picture books and young adult novels written by Collins.

Dates

  • 1980 - 2012

Biographical / Historical

Pat Lowery Collins is a writer and fine art painter. She has written works for both children and young adults, and taught creative writing at Lesley University. She lives in Rockport, Massachusetts.
